I've just gotten a new computer. Downloaded and installed the most recent version of Audacity and the LAME encoder but still have no export option available.
I have used Audacity for years to record vinyl for my weekly online radio program. I cannot use any new albums on the show until I get this sorted.
My turntable connects to a mixer which connects to the soundcard via the Line In jack. I can hear the record and I believe I can record it as well, I just can't export it to .MP3, which does me no good.
There are NO export options available when I click on the File menu.
Any ideas? I need to find a way to record my albums.
I have included a screenshot to show what appears when I pull down the File menu.

No you're not stupid - you are one of the smarter folk who knows you have to export non-native data like audio files.Fyve_by_Fyve wrote:THANK YOU. Now I see it. Simple solution (yes, i feel stupid).
We moved the Exports being the "Save Other" as so many folk kept trying to "Save" audio files
The only thing you can "Save" with Audacity is an Audacity Project (native data).

The best workaround is to use the keyboard shortcuts:
a) Ctrl + Shift + E for Export Audio
B) Ctrl + Shift + L for Export Multiple
You can assign your own shortcuts to the Exports to particular formats WAV, MP3 and OGG if required - and you can make single key shortcuts for the existing two.
